What We Bring to Site

Commercial-Grade Equipment, Not Rental-Store Fans

Our Bowling Green trucks carry the same class of equipment used on large commercial losses: truck-mounted extraction units, low-grain-refrigerant dehumidifiers, high-velocity air movers, and moisture meters capable of reading behind walls without cutting into them.

That equipment difference matters. A rental-store fan moves air across a surface; our dehumidification setup actively pulls moisture out of the air and out of building materials, cutting drying time from weeks down to days in most Bowling Green jobs.

Beyond the Shop Vac

Why Professional Sewage Cleanup Beats DIY Cleanup in Bowling Green

Plenty of Bowling Green homeowners try to handle a small water event themselves before calling us. Here's what usually gets missed.

The visible water on your Bowling Green floor is often only part of the problem. Water wicks upward into drywall, travels along subfloor seams, and pools inside wall cavities where a rented fan will never reach it. Without professional-grade dehumidification and moisture monitoring, that hidden dampness can sit for weeks, quietly feeding mold growth long after the surface looks and feels dry to the touch.

Insurance carriers generally want to see documented proof that a water loss was properly mitigated. A DIY cleanup rarely produces that kind of record, which can leave Bowling Green homeowners exposed if related damage — like mold or warped subfloor — shows up months later and the carrier questions whether it was handled correctly the first time.

If the water was minor, contained, and cleaned up within an hour or two, DIY handling is often fine. Once it's soaked into materials or sat for any real length of time, though, a professional assessment is the safer move for your Bowling Green property.

While You Wait

Immediate Safety Steps for Bowling Green Property Owners

The minutes before our Bowling Green crew arrives matter. Here's what our dispatchers typically recommend, situation permitting.

1

Stop the Source if Safe

If the water is coming from a pipe, appliance, or fixture you can safely reach, shut off the supply valve or main.

2

Stay Clear of Outlets

Never touch electrical switches, outlets, or appliances that are wet or near standing water — the risk of shock is real.

3

Move Valuables to Dry Ground

If it's safe, move furniture, electronics, and important documents away from the affected area or up off the floor.

4

Document the Damage

Snap photos or video of the affected areas before anything is moved — this helps your insurance claim later.

5

Open Windows & Doors

If weather allows, opening windows or doors can help slow humidity buildup until our Bowling Green team arrives with drying equipment.

6

Don't Wait to Call

Delaying the call is the most common mistake we see. Standing water only gets more expensive to fix the longer it sits.
